This classic crawfish etouffée brings the rich, savoury flavours of Louisiana to your kitchen in a lighter, diabetes-friendly format. By using a simple cornflour slurry rather than a traditional heavy roux, this dish achieves a beautifully thick and glossy sauce while remaining mindful of nutritional balance. The combination of the 'holy trinity'—onions, peppers and celery—provides a fragrant, aromatic base that perfectly complements the delicate sweetness of the tender crawfish tails.
Ideal for a comforting mid-week supper or a relaxed weekend dinner with guests, this seafood dish is both nutritious and deeply satisfying. Serve it over a small portion of steamed basmati or brown rice to soak up the spiced gravy. Bursting with fresh parsley and spring onions, it offers a vibrant, homemade alternative to heavier stews, proving that heart-healthy cooking never needs to compromise on authentic flavour.

Ingredients for Crawfish Etouffée
900g peeled crawfish tails
1 stick (8 tablespoons ) butter
450g chopped onions
100g chopped green peppers
120ml chopped celery
1 tablespoon cornflour
240ml water
Salt and cayenne pepper, to taste
50g chopped spring onions
1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
How to make Crawfish Etouffée
Melt the butter in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the onions, peppers, and celery and cook, stirring, until the vegetables are soft and golden, 8 to 10 minutes. Add the crawfish tails and cook, stirring occasionally, until they throw off some of their liquid, 6 to 8 minutes.
Dissolve the cornflour in the water and add to the crawfish mixture. Simmer, stirring occasionally, until the mixture thickens, 4 to 5 minutes. Season with salt and cayenne.
Serve immediately over steamed rice. Garnish with a sprinkling of spring onions and parsley.
